Eagles Down Titans
2/26/2008 10:14:47 PM | Tennis
Claim five out of six singles matches
FULLERTON, Cal.- The Eastern Michigan University tennis team rolled to a 6-1 non-conference victory over host Cal State Fullerton Tuesday, Feb. 26, at the Titan Courts.
With the win, the Eagles improve to 4-5, while the Titans lose their eighth straight and fall to 1-8.
"We had a solid effort today," said head coach Ryan Ray "Some of the ladies did a good job of adjusting their games to the windy conditions to be successful. We'll rest up for a day tomorrow and look for a solid effort against a good Loyola Marymount program on Thursday."
The Eagles got right out of the blocks, sweeping the doubles points. Vanessa Frankowski and Tina Bestehorn teamed up at the top flight, winning by an 8-3 score. The other duo, newcomers Aleksandra Stankovic and Sandra Wikstrom, took down the opposition by an 8-4 score.
In singles play, EMU won five out of six flights, with only one victory being forced to three sets. Frankowski, at the No. 1 slot, lost just three games in the win. At the third spot, Wikstrom battled back from a first-set loss to win by a score of 3-6, 6-1, 6-1, for her first singles win of the season.
Bestehorn won her second straight match, losing just one game, winning by a score of 6-1, 6-0. Stankovic posted straight-set wins at the fifth flight, losing just six games.
The final win for the Eagles was junior Joanna Woo, battling it out till the end by a score of 7-6, 6-2.
The lone point for the Titans came when CSF's Erin Wiesener slid past EMU's Aditi Krishnan in three sets. Wiesener won the first set, but dropped the second set 6-1. The third set was close, as Wisener squeaked past with a 6-4 set win.
The Green and White will rest for a day before traveling west to face the No. 72 Loyola Marymount University Lions. Match time is set for 2 p.m. (PT) at the LMU Tennis Center.
Eastern Michigan 6, Cal State Fullerton 1
SINGLES
1. Vanessa Frankowski (EMU) def. Shelly Injejikian (CSF), 6-2, 6-1
2. Erin Wiesener (CSF) def. Aditi Krishnan (EMU), 6-1, 1-6, 6-4
3. Sandra Wikstrom (EMU) def. Karina Akhmedova (CSF), 3-6, 6-1, 6-1
4. Catharina Bestehorn (EMU) def. Jerusha Cruz (CSF), 6-1, 6-0
5. Aleksandra Stankovic (EMU) def. Cheyenne Inglis (CSF), 6-3, 6-3
6. Joanna Woo (EMU) def. Brandy Andrews (CSF), 7-6, 6-2
DOUBLES
1. Bestehorn/Frankowski (EMU) def. Akhmedova/Injejikian (CSF), 8-3
2. Stankovic/Wikstrom (EMU) def. Cruz/Wiesener (CSF), 8-4
3. Andrews/Inglis (CSF) def. Krishnan/Woo (EMU), 8-6
